This Mirassol vs Gremio prediction centers on a bottom-half Serie A Brazil clash between two sides fighting for security rather than glory. Mirassol sit 19th with just 16 points from 17 games, sliding toward the relegation mix, while Gremio occupy 15th on 21 points and remain safer but far from convincing.

Mirassol's home record is actually their saving grace this season, with three wins and three draws from nine at home, and they showed real quality beating Fluminense and Corinthians in recent weeks. But their away form has been dismal, and inconsistency across all competitions has plagued their campaign.

Gremio arrive with six days' rest after a run of friendlies and limited competitive rhythm, though their away record is concerning with zero wins in nine league trips. Their defense has tightened lately with five clean sheets, but goals have been hard to come by on the road.

Head-to-head meetings in the past two years split 2-0 to the home side in both cases, with Mirassol thrashing Gremio 4-1 at home in April 2025. That pattern supports the home-favorite bookmaker line here.

With bookmakers backing Mirassol at 47.7% and only 24.1% for Gremio, home advantage and recent scoring form make Mirassol the sharper pick, though a draw remains a live outcome given both teams' inconsistent away form and combined goal output hovering near 2.2 per game.

Mirassol vs Gremio - Match Analysis

Why is Mirassol favored despite sitting lower in the Serie A Brazil table?

Mirassol's overall record looks poor, but their home form is genuinely solid with three wins and three draws from nine matches. Gremio, despite being four places higher, have failed to win any of their nine away league games this season. Bookmakers weight home-field patterns heavily here, and recent head-to-head meetings also favored the home side twice running, all supporting Mirassol as favorites at 47.7%.

How does Gremio's away form affect this prediction?

Gremio's away record is a major red flag — zero wins in nine league away matches this season, with four draws and five losses. This poor road form is the single biggest factor working against them here, even though they sit four places above Mirassol in the table. Their inability to convert opportunities away from home directly supports the home win prediction in this matchup.
